Redefining the Bad Boy: Challenging Stereotypes with Swagger
Kard takes the archetype of the ‘bad boy’ and spins it on its head. Rather than embracing the trope as a rebellious figure detached from societal norms, the group reclaims it as a self-empowered individual who refuses to be defined by others. The lyrics ‘Bad boy, 그래 난 bad boy 생각해 네가 하고픈 대로’ translate to an invitation to perceive them as one chooses—their true selves remain uncompromised, unapologetic and raw.
In an industry saturated with manufactured images and idol personas, Kard’s stance is not only refreshing but also subversive. The flaunting of the bad boy image becomes a conduit to express their genuine selves, untouched and uninfluenced by the stereotypes that often bind artists in a restrictive cocoon of expectations.
Volume Up on Life: The Quest for Audacious Authenticity
Far from being a mere backdrop to the lyrics, the music enhances the essence of ‘Dumb Litty.’ With its bass-heavy beat and clashing drums, the track mimics the chaos and excitement of casting aside inhibition. It offers an auditory experience that mirrors the feeling of turning the volume up on life itself—embracing one’s truths, no matter how loud or disruptive they may be.
Kard doesn’t just bring the party; they become the party, drawing listeners into their sphere of self-acceptance where everyone is invited to turn up their own volumes. The directive to ‘눈치 보지 말고 volume up up up’ (Don’t pay attention, turn the volume up) becomes a metaphor for living loudly and proudly in one’s own skin.
